Budgets are tight, and lists are long. Here is this year's top 10 list of thoughtful, yet budget friendly, (and Eco-friendly) unique gifts from Sheffield MacIntyre owner of BackinStyle.com, a vintage & designer clothing & accessories website that supplies one of a kind items to celebrities, magazines, movies, and couture fashion houses.
For your secret Santa:
It may seem challenging to find something significant for under $25 these days, but it's not. How about a piece of vintage jewelry. For him try a funky or classic vintage tie. Both are sure to fit, and look way more expensive than they really are. There are lots of online vintage sites with these items starting at just $10.
Your female co-worker:
Add some pizzaz to her work wardrobe with a rhinestone brooch. Plan to spend around $35 for a nice one. Festive, yet feminine, there are a million ways she can wear it; in her hair, on her handbag, on her scarf, on her hat, or the usual jacket lapel.
Your male co-workers:
Help him get the promotion he deserves by having him dress the part. Spruce up his look with a designer tie. Super affordable, with plenty of options out there starting at just $10, you can buy one for each man in the office.
For your intern:
At the end of the day, when you can't wait to sit go home and sit on the couch, she is making plans to go out! A fabulous vintage clutch that she can throw in her work bag and pull out for a night on the town, makes an affordable and thoughtful gift.
For your mentor:
A vintage designer scarf is the perfect gift. Classic and sophisticated, it will show her how much you respect and admire her, with out being over the top.
For your sister, the girl who has always borrowed your clothes:
You already know what she likes. Just pick something similar to what she used to steal from your closet. Or just give her that item she is coveting from your closet, and buy something new for yourself...
For your best friend:
Buy her something she probably wouldn't purchase for herself. A vintage fur stole. I know it seems opulent and totally over the top, but you can find them at second hand stores for $100. Cozy and warm, yet very glamorous, it is both practical, and extravagant at the same time.
Your brothers, or brother-in-law:
You thought this one was hard, but now it is simple, Cuff links! The hottest new accessory for men. Budget friendly, usually running between $25-$35, and unique, they make the perfect thoughtful gesture without looking like you are trying too hard.
Your vintage loving friend:
Can't afford a fab designer piece, but know she would love it? Try a vintage designer tie. She can wear it as a belt, in her hair, tied loosely around her neck, in a bow on her handbag. The possibilities are endless.
For the girl who has everything:
A gift certificate, to a vintage store of course. Then she can pick from the hundreds of unique items. They are all one of a kind, so she is certain to find something she doesn't already have.
